Fig. 1From: Relationship of sleep duration with incident cardiovascular outcomes: a prospective study of 33,883 adults in a general populationCubic spline curves for the relationship between sleep duration and incident CVD in participants ≥ 50y (A: all participants, B: participants without any health conditions, C: participants with one or more health conditions). The model is adjusted for age, gender, marital status, education level, occupation, smoking, drinking, physical activity, BMI, sleep medication, and depression. HR: hazard ratio. 8 h/day is used as the referenceBack to article page
